ITC slips 1.15% as cigarette tax overhang clouds FMCG beat; analysts split on FY27 outlook

ITC stock fell to ₹304.50 after GST on cigarettes jumped from 28% to 40% of retail price. FMCG arm impressed with 15% revenue growth and 200bps EBIT margin expansion to 8.3%, while cigarette EBIT beat consensus by 15%. But brokerages model FY27 cigarette volumes down 8% and EBIT down 17%, with target prices spanning ₹290-394.
